Output 3fc670c911179fdd9e722d6bff63b280aa9ff118ffa0cd06d5f4deccb81593b7:1

value
503385274
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99f8a8979d058f359976baaeec9a68eb6e8df6da OP_EQUAL
address
2N7HMFjX2qg63jiY5qPuwA5uMb9V36AEaFW
transaction
3fc670c911179fdd9e722d6bff63b280aa9ff118ffa0cd06d5f4deccb81593b7